Dean Friedman

Dean Friedman is an American singer-songwriter known for his work in the soft rock and pop genres. Emerging in the late 1970s, Friedman gained recognition for his storytelling lyrics and melodic compositions, often drawing comparisons to artists like Paul Simon and Harry Chapin. His sound is characterized by a blend of acoustic guitar, piano, and rich vocal harmonies, creating warm and introspective songs. Friedman's most notable tracks include "Ariel" and "Lucky Stars," which showcase his knack for crafting relatable narratives and catchy hooks.
